    Quick Introduction to Caye Caulker

    Average price for a bed: Hostels in Caye Caulker cost 13€ – 22€ per night for a bed in a dorm. A private room starts from 52€ up to 75€ per night. This is a rough average just to give you an idea.

    Prices always depend on season and holidays. Please always check exact rates on Hostelz.com or Hostelworld.com.

    Check-In and Check Out: The average check-in time is from 15:00 (3pm), while the Check-Out time is before 11:00 (11am). Hostels usually offer luggage storage in case you arrive earlier or leave later. Make sure you check if luggage storage is free or if there is an extra cost.

    Activities in Caye Caulker: There are tons of exciting activities to experience on the island, such as swimming in the secret cenotes, snorkeling in the shallow reefs, and exploring the nearby islands by kayak. The island has a vibrant culinary scene, with street food and small restaurants offering up tasty dishes from around the world. And for the night owls out there, there are beach bars and clubs that stay open until the early hours of the morning. 

    Safety in Caye Caulker: Caye Caulker is generally considered to be a safe destination for tourists. Crime rates are relatively low and public safety is taken very seriously by local authorities and the community. The island has very few problems with violent crimes and there are no gangs or organized crime groups. 

    Best time to visit Caye Caulker: The best time to visit Caye Caulker is generally in the dry season between November and May. This is when the weather is warm and dry and the Caribbean Sea is at its most inviting, making it perfect for beach activities.

    1. Go Slow Guesthouse

    Tucked around the corner from the main strip, this family-run hostel is set at the heart of Caye Caulker approximately 5 minute’s walk away from everything you might need during your stay.
    The staff live on the property and are very helpful as well as very knowledgeable about the area.

    They’re always available to recommend and organize plenty of excursions that you can enjoy on this stunning island.

    Go Slow Guesthouse is also just a 2 minutes’ walk to the split, one of the most popular beach destinations on the island and a great place where you can snorkel for free.

    This hostel is designed to give you rest. For that reason, there are a lot of nice chill spots with benches, lounging chairs, and hammocks where you can kick back and relax or join other guests for a chat.

    If you’re an eco-traveler you’ll appreciate the fact that all the rooms are air-conditioned but only at night which is a relief in the Belizean moist tropical climate and at the same time good for the environment.

    Although the social vibe is great, this hostel gets quiet at night. It’s a great option if you want to have a peaceful night. That also means it might not be the place for you if you’re looking to party.
    However, thanks to its strategic location you’ll find many drinking and partying dens on the doorstep. So you can step out for a fun night out then head back to Go Slow Guesthouse for a peaceful sleep.

    Each dorm bed has a power outlet where you can easily charge your electronics and there’s wifi connectivity throughout the property which makes working remotely blissful.

    Be sure to take advantage of the free bikes and kayaks to explore the island.

    One of the downsides that might be a little bit inconvenient is that they don’t have bag lockers, but there’s a small lockable drawer where you can keep your valuables. Plus, each room has a keypad lock for that extra security.

    Location: Go Slow Guesthouse is centrally located and just a few minutes’ walk from the ferry dock.

    The hostel is close to a lot of nice restaurants but if you’d rather prepare your meals, the property boasts a decent kitchen with all necessary appliances.

    2. Sophie's Guest Rooms

    Sophie's Guest Rooms is a pleasant low key and comfy place to stay in Caye Caulker. The staff is incredibly nice and helpful which gives this place a welcoming vibe.

    The hostel boasts an enviable location and being just seven minutes away from the Split is a huge perk.

    It’s also about 3 minutes’ walk from the island’s main bar, the Lazy Lizard where you can go to hang out, meet people and enjoy beautiful sunset views.

    Although the hostel is a walking distance of every fun and excitement that the island has to offer, it’s also slightly tucked away in a quieter street making it a perfect tranquil haven to go home to after a long day of exploring the island.

    With a true beachfront location, this hostel offers astounding views of the Caribbean Sea and allows you to enjoy water sports activities right from your doorstep.

    There are only 5 rooms each with 1 double bed and 1 single bed. So even at its full capacity, the hostel never feels crowded.

    The beds are comfortable, and each one of them comes with a nightstand, as well as a safe where you can stash your valuables.

    You’ll also have storage space for your clothes.

    For caffeine lovers, you’ll enjoy the complimentary coffee offered every morning.

    Every room has a hammock on the veranda outside from where you can enjoy magical views of the sunset with a beer in your hand.

    The rooms come with a personal sink, there is a microwave where you can warm your meals, and a fridge to store beverages or leftovers.

    3. Bella's Backpackers Hostel

    If you’re looking for a party hostel that’s also cheap, Bella's Backpackers Hostel is one of the best options in Caye Caulker.

    For the price, this hostel has a lot to offer including a bar right near the shore where you can share a beer with many people who frequent the area.

    Its location makes it easy to meet new faces every day making it a nice place for solo travelers looking to socialize.

    It’s set in a superb location and everything you might need including supermarkets, restaurants, and souvenir shops is all within five minutes walk radius.

    Bella’s features a sandy oceanfront backyard with hammocks, a lovely seating area, and a volleyball net.

    This is where both the locals and backpackers convene making it a fantastic place to socialize with people from all walks of life.

    That said, the backyard is one of the local’s favorite hangout areas and although this gives the hostel a vibrant social scene, it also means there’ll be a lot of strangers within the property’s vicinity which might make some people uncomfortable.

    With its rustic wooden design, that contrasts perfectly with the white interior this hostel ooze laidback vibes and there are a lot of places to relax especially on the outside.

    There are also nice spots where you can chill and marvel at the sunset or the sunrise and the free canoes comes as a nice addition.

    The beds are good enough for a comfortable sleep and there’s a well-equipped kitchen where you can make your food.

    The hostel boasts private rooms and a dorm both fitted with AC, mosquito nets, and even mosquito coils to keep the bugs away.

    The staff is welcoming and they can offer invaluable information about the island including the best places to explore, nice restaurants, and bars.

    But most importantly they organize excursions, such as boat trips, with sunset cruise being one of the best as well as other activities such as snorkeling.

    You’ll find people partying, drinking, and exchanging stories in the backyard till late and the living area is pretty close to some dorms making it hard for people to have a peaceful night’s sleep.

    But as stated above, this hostel is best suited for party animals and backpackers who don’t have a problem with sleeping in the wee hours of the night.

    Location: The hostel is in a great location, just a short walk to the ferry dock and the Split.

    Tips for Backpacking in Caye Caulker

    Go Slow

    Caye Caulker’s motto is “go slow” and everyone on the island seemingly abides by it.

    They take it so seriously that there are no cars, save for the few government vehicles. So you must explore the island by foot, golf cart, or bike.

    Bring a refillable water bottle

    It’s not safe to drink tap water on this island and some places will charge you for a distilled water refill. So be sure to pack a water bottle with a filter and fill it up at the hostel to save some bucks.

    Travel during the off-season

    It’s a universally known truth that the off-season brings some irresistible deals on accommodations.

    Top that up with fewer people as well as nicer weather and you’ll have one more reason to fall in love with Caye Caulker.

    Make the most of the Happy Hour

    Many restaurants and bars across the island offer nice happy hour deals which can come in handy if you’re on a shoestring budget.

    Stores off the main strip are cheaper

    If you’re staying longer on the island and you prefer preparing your meals, you’ll bag better prices at the stores off the main strip.
